What types of immigration cases do attorneys in the Fanwood, NJ area typically handle?
Immigration attorneys serving Fanwood and Union County commonly handle a wide range of cases, including family-based petitions (green cards for spouses, parents, and children), naturalization (U.S. citizenship), work visas (H-1B, L-1, O-1), deportation defense, and asylum applications. Given Fanwood's proximity to major employment hubs like Newark and New York City, many local attorneys also have significant experience with employment-based immigration for professionals working in those metropolitan areas. They are well-versed in navigating both the Newark and New York City USCIS field offices and immigration courts.
How can I find a reputable and trustworthy immigration lawyer in Fanwood, NJ?
Start by seeking referrals from local community organizations in Fanwood or nearby Scotch Plains and Westfield, such as cultural associations or public libraries that may host legal clinics. The New Jersey State Bar Association's lawyer referral service is a reliable resource. It's crucial to verify an attorney is in good standing with the New Jersey Supreme Court and is a member of the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A). Many reputable attorneys in the area offer initial consultations, which allow you to assess their experience with cases similar to yours and their familiarity with local USCIS procedures.
Are there any local resources or non-profits in Fanwood that provide low-cost immigration legal help?
While Fanwood itself is a smaller residential borough, residents have access to several nearby organizations. In neighboring Union County, you can contact the American Friends Service Committee in Newark or Catholic Charities of the Archdiocese of Newark, which offer immigration legal services on a sliding scale. Additionally, the Rutgers Law School clinics in Newark sometimes provide pro bono assistance. For immediate guidance, the Fanwood Memorial Library may have information on upcoming legal aid workshops or know-your-rights sessions hosted in the community.
What should I expect during the U.S. citizenship (naturalization) process with a local Fanwood attorney?
A local immigration attorney will first review your eligibility, focusing on your continuous residence and physical presence requirements, which are adjudicated based on your local filing address. They will help you prepare and file Form N-400, gather necessary documents, and prepare you for the civics and English tests. Your interview and oath ceremony will likely be scheduled at the USCIS Newark Field Office. Your attorney can provide specific guidance on the processing times for the Newark office, accompany you to the interview, and help address any issues that arise, such as traffic violations or extended trips abroad that might affect your application.
If I'm facing deportation proceedings, how does being in Fanwood, NJ affect my legal options?
Your case venue is critical. If you receive a Notice to Appear (NTA), your removal proceedings will likely be held at the Immigration Court in Newark, NJ, which has jurisdiction over Fanwood residents. A local attorney will be familiar with the judges, court procedures, and asylum grant rates at the Newark court. They can explore all forms of relief available to you, such as cancellation of removal, asylum, or adjustment of status. Given New Jersey's policies, they can also advise on any potential state-based protections or resources that may support your case while you reside in Fanwood.
